Refra presented R290 Heat Pumps

Small capacity reversible heat pumps with the heating power from 20 kW to 55 kW are designed for small commercial or industrial applications. Manufactured using R290 refrigerant only and full-inverter technology the units are a part of the extremely economical and environmentally friendly Refra product line. These single circuit heat pumps can be used for heating purposes at ambient temperature of -15°or higher as well as for cooling purposes with the capacity of 20 kW to 50 kW. This dual solution is very efficient in terms of price, installation and space, as there is no need to install two separate systems.

Compact frame construction is assembled with highquality EC fan motor technology, finned tube heat exchangers and reciprocating compressors. To prevent ice formation, the frame is equipped with special water drain outlets, which are required to ensure a proper defrosting process. It is also recommended to place the unit on a platform in order to leave some space underneath for water to drain. The galvanized steel and powder coated frame with a reliable insulation material ensures proper unit protection and noise reduction. An additional 30 mm rock wool material can be supplemented for a super silent unit operation with double insulation.

PARTS INCLUDED:

Bitzer Reciprocating compressors with oil charge and oil level monitoring/differential pressure switch;
Polymer powder painted RAL7035 frame;
Frequency inverters on all compressors;
HP/LP pressure switch per circuit;
HP/LP pressure gauges per circuit;
Necessary pressure and temperature probes;
Liquid receiver per circuit;
Air cooled condenser (copper tubes - aluminium fins);
4-way valve for reversible operation;
Single safety valve per circuit;
Filter drier on liquid line per circuit;
Sight glass on liquid line per circuit;
Electronic expansion valve per circuit;
Control board with Siemens Climatix controller;
Suction line accumulator per circuit;
Vibration absorbers;
BPHE evaporator;
R290 leak detector;
Emergency EX fan;
EC Fans;
Muffler.
